before we approach the special cure, which should vary somewhat according to the diverse species of dropsy: namely, the drying and extraction of superfluities, and then the opening of the pores of the body and skin. For nothing harms dropsical patients so much as the restriction of the passages, as is stated in Haly's Practice, in the proper chapter.
53. According to Galen's decree, the cure is reduced to three aims or intentions: namely, that we heal the ailment of the viscus, that we apply those things which dissolve humidities and flatulence, and that we provide diuretics.
54. Therefore, Ascites abdominal dropsy is to be cured by the evacuation of water, which is contrary to the whole nature of the body's substance; Tympanites windy dropsy by the resolution of windiness; and Anasarca generalized dropsy by the drawing out of the troubling phlegm.
55. Of the purgative remedies, the lighter ones are safer, especially if they strengthen the parts at the same time with a peculiar power, such as Aloe and Rhubarb—the former friendly to the stomach, the latter to the liver—and those which are called hydragoga water-drawing because they move waters, such as Agaric, the juice of the Iris root, and the bark and juice from the fruit of the Danewort and Elder. But the stronger ones among these are less safe, which are not to be used unless the greatest necessity urges it, such as convolvulus, spurge-laurel, Mezereon, elaterium, colocynth, Euphorbium, hellebore, and the like, to which we also add Antimony, which in our age is accustomed to be used too rashly by any unskilled person in any disease whatsoever, even without the cause being known.
56. And in the use of all these and similar things, respect should always be had not so much for the cause and symptoms of the disease as for the patient's strength, age, time, and other factors enumerated above.
